Had a Wii and PS3 since the 1st day and there are certainly differences between the two! The Wii is a physically stimulating system with plenty of fun games, typical of Nintendo.

The PS3 I have 1 game Blazing Angels which is a great WW2 flying game, I have also downloaded 4 demos, 2 racing, 1 lemmings and 1 Resistance: Fall of Man. My son beat Resistance demo in 10 minutes I am still trying 2 months later!

Great Blu-Ray player fantastic images on my 100" screen and to date no overheating issues, fan noise, freeze ups or other problems that seem to have plagued others.

Base your choice on what you want and will use:thumbup:
